Программное задающее устройство для электронных аналоговых регуляторов Советский патент 1982 года по МПК G05B19/07 

Описание патента на изобретение SU932463A1

(54) ПРОГРАММНОЕ ЗАДАЮЩЕЕ УСТРОЙСТВО ДЛЯ ЭЛЕКТРОННЫХ АНАЛОГОВЫХ РЕГУЛЯТОРОВ Изобретение относится к автоматизации производственных процессов и предназначено для формирования задания электронным аналоговым регулятором. Известны программные устройства содержащие шаговый переключатель, диодный коммутатор и штеккеры со встроенными в них диодами. Для изменения программы работы устройств необходимо осуществить перестановку штеккеров в точках коммутации П. К недостаткам данных устройств можно отнести невозможность дистанционного или автоматического изменения программы, например, с центрального диспетчерского пункта или от управляю щей вычислительной машины более высокого уровня, а также-большой объем коммутационной матрицы. Известны также коммутаторы, содержащие п горизонтальных и m вертикальных шин, в точках коммутации которых СТОЯТ запоминающие коммутационные .элементы t2. Недостатком описанных устройств является большое количество запоминающих элементов в коммутационной матрице, число которых равно п х т. Наиболее близким по технической сущности к предлагаемому является программное задающее устройство для выдачи установок аналоговым регуляторам, содержащее задающий генератор импульсов, распределитель импульсов, выполненный в виде двоичного счетчика и дешифратора, коммутатор, содержащий п горизонтальных и п вертикальных шин и выходной преобразователь последовательного кода в аналоговый сигнал, содержащий п токовых ключей приращений функции 3. Недостатком известного устройства является большой объем коммутационной матрицы, содержащей п горизбнтальных и га вертикальных шин, а следовательно, п X ш точек коммутации. 393 Цель изобретения - упрощение устройства путем сокращения точек коммутации коммутатора. Поставленная цель достигается тем что в устройство, содержащее генератор импульсов, распределитель импульсов, соединенный выходами с горизонтальными шинами коммутатора и выходной цифроаналоговый преобразователь введены реверсивный шаговый переключатель, элемент задержки и элемент ИЛИ, причем одна из вертикальных шин коммутатора через последовательно соединенные элемент задержки и элемент ИЛИ подключена к входу распределителя импульса, а две другие вертикальные шины - соответственно к суммирующим и вычитающим входам реверсивного шагового переключателя, выходы которого соединены с входами цифроаналогового преобразователя, а выход генератора импульсов подключен к.второ му входу элемента ИЛИ. На фиг. 1 изображена схема устройства; на фиг. 2 - пример реализации графика заданной функции. Устройство (фиг. 1) содержит горизонтальные шины 1-12 коммутатора 13, соединенные с выходами распределителя lA импульсов. Вхрд последнего соединен с выходом элемента ИЛИ If, один вход которого подключен к выходу генератора 1б импульсов, а другой через -элемент 17 задержки - к вертикальной шине 18 коммутатора 13. Вертикальные шины 19 и 20 коммутатора соединены с вычитающим и суммирующим входами реверсивного шагового переключателя 21, выходы которого подключены к выходному цифроаналоговому преобразователю 22. В точках пересечения горизонтальных и вертикальных шин коммутатора установлены запоминающие коммутационные элементы 23, содержащие двухпозиционные реле 24, с контактом 25, соединяющим соответствующую горизонталь ную и вертикальную шину, кнопку 26включения и кнопку 27 отключения запоминающего элемента. На фиг. 2 представлен график заданной функции поясняющий принцип работы устройства, где ut - шаг кван тования по времени; у аргументы заданной функции; ду - величина квантования заданной функции; дТ технологическая задержка. Требуемый вид графика заданной функции определяется программированием коммутатора 13, посредством включения определенных З коммутационных запоминащих элемен тов 23 Каждый коммутационный элемент может находиться в одном из двух устойчивых состояний: включен Замкнут контакт 25, соединяющий вертикальную и горизонтальную шину, и выключен - разомкнут контакт 25. Включение коммутационного элемента осуществляется подачей сигнала с кнопки 26, а отключение - 27. Программирование коммутатора может осуществляться дистанционно, для чего кнопки включения и отключения коммутациониых элементов необходимо вынести на пульт управления. Программирование коммутатора производится до включения устройства на реализацию заданной функции. Формирование сигнала задания авторегулятору в соответствии с графиком заданной функции осуществляется следующим образом. Импульсы с генератора 1б через промежутки времени, равные шагу квантования по времени At, поступают че рез элемент ИЛИ 15 на вход распределителя 1, который последовательно подает сигналы на горизонтальные шины 1-12 коммутатора 13. Каждая горизонтальная шина может быть соединена посредством запоминающих коммутационных элементов 23 с вертикальной шиной 20 либо 19. В первом случае си|- нал поступает на суммирующий вход реверсивного шагового переключателя 21 и увеличивает аргумент заданной функЦИИ на величину единичного приращения д у. Во втором, случае сигнал поступает на вычитающий вход реверсивного шагового переключателя 21 и уменьшает аргумент заданной функции на величину ду. При необходимости изменить значение аргумента в определенный момент времени на величину большую и кратную Ду коммутационные элементы, соединяющие соответствующие,горизонтальные с вертикальными шинами 18 и 19 или. 20 должны находиться во включенном состоянии. В этом случае си1- нал поступает одновременно на вход реверсивного шагового переключателя 21 и через вертикальную шину 18 коммутатора 13 на элемент 17 задержки. С элемента IJ задержки через элемент /цц с; сигнал поступает на вход распределителя 14 и переводит его в следующее состояние. Время технологической задержки выбирается равным или незначительно большим времени срабатывания реверсивного шагового переключателя для исключения явления со-, стязаний элементов. При необходимости увеличения времени выдержки на определенной ступени задания на величину, превышающую и кратную At, коммутационные элементы 23, установленные в точках пересечения соответствующих горизонтальных шин с вертикальными, должны находиться в выю1юченном состоянии. В этом случае сигналы с выхода распределителя 1k, поступающие на соответствующие горизонтальные шины, не проходят на вертикальные шины коммутатора и на входы реверсивного шагового переключателя, и аргумент функции сохраняет свое прежнее значение, В качестве запоминающих коммутационных элементов 23 могут служить как двухпозиционные электромагнитные реле с замыкающим контактом, так и бесконтактные ключи, управляемые триггерамиj установленными на управляющих входах ключей. В качестве реверсивного шагового переключателя 2I и выходного преобразователя 22 могут служить либо шаговый искатель и подключенные к его клеммам сопротивления, соответствующие установкам задания аргумента, либо реверсивный двоичный счетчик и цифроаналоговый преобразователь. Пример конкретной реализации заданной функции представлен на фиг. . Коммутационные элементы 23, показанные на фиг. 1 заштрихованными, условимся считать включенными. В этом случае, в момент времени t, первый импульс генератора 16 импульсов уста навливает распределитель 1 в первое состояние. Сигнал с выхода распределителя Ц импульсов через шины 1 и 2 коммутатора 13 поступает на суммирую щий вход реверсивного шагового переключателя 21 и переводит его в состо яние, соответствующее у. Как видно из графика фиг. 2, в момент времени tf необходимо трехкратное увеличение на ду значения аргумента. Для реали зации такого задания сигнал с выхода распределителя 1А поступает одновременно через горизонтальную шину 2 и вертикальные шины 20. и 18 коммутатор 13 соответственно на суммирующий вход реверсивного шагового переключателя 21, увеличивая значение аргумента до величины у, и через элемент 17 .задержки, через элемент ИЛИ 15 на зход распределителя 14 импульсов, который в следующее состояние и сигнал поступает через коммутатор 13 .на суммирующий вход реверсивного шагового переключателя 21, изменяя значение аргумента до величины у. Аналогично происходит увеличение аргумента до величины УА . В момент времени t j сигнал с выхода распределителя k импульсов через шины 5 и 20 коммутатора 13 поступает на суммирующий вход реверсивного шагового переключателя 21 импульсов, увеличивая аргумент до значения у. В момент времени t сигнал с выхода распределителя 1 .через шины 6 и 19 коммутатора 13 поступает на вычитающий вход реверсивного шагового переключателя 21 и уменьшает значение аргумента до величины у. В момент времени tj в соответствии с заданием необходимо уменьшить значение аргумента до величины у, т. е. на 2 ду. Эта задача выполняется следующим образом. Сигнал с выхода 6 распределителя Ц импульсов поступает одновременно через вертикальные шины 19 и 18 соответственно на вычитающий вход реверсивного шагового переключателя 21, уменьшая величину аргумента до значения yj и через элемент 17 технологической задержки, элемент ИЛ(Г 15 на вход распределителя 14. С выхода последнего сигнал поступает через шины 7 и 19 коммутатора 13 на вычитающий вход реверсивного шагового переключателя 21 и приводит значение аргумента к .величине у. В моменты времени t и t- аргумент сохраняет прежнее значение у, так как отключены коммутационные элементы 23, соединяющие соответственно горизонтальные шины 9 и 10 коммутатора 13 с вертикальными шинами. В момент времени tg и tq сигналы с выходов распределителя импульсов поступают через шины 11, 12, 20 коммутатора 13 на суммирующий вход реверсивного шагового переключателя 21 и увеличивают значение аргумента до величин у, а затем у . Предлагаемое устройство позволяет сократ.ить число точек коммутации, а следовательно, и число запоминающих коммутационных элементов в-.,раз, rXll- 2) где пит - число горизонтальных и вертикальных шин коммутатора, установленного б устройстве, взятом за прототип: S. число дополнительных горизонтальных шин, которые требуется установить в коммутаторе заявляемого устройства для возможности переключе ния аргумента на величину превышаклцу единичное приращение аргумента. Экономия от сокращения стоимости на одно программное задающее устройство зависит от конкретной элементарной базы и от вида реализуемых программ (продолжительность по време ни, дискретность по времени и аргументу) и в общем случае равна Э К,.эДпСт-3)-313 -Кр.ц.. Где. К| 3 - стоимость коммутационного элемента; Р ш ff стоимость реверсивного ша гового переключателя. Формула изобретения Программное задающее устройство для электронных аналоговых регуляторов, содержащее генератор импульсов, распределитель импульсов, соединенны выходами с горизонтальными шинами ко мутатора и выходной цифроаналоговый преобразователь, отличающее с я тем, что, с целью упрощения устройства путем сокращения коммутирующих элементов коммутатора, в него введены реверсивный шаговый переключатель , элемент задержки и элемент ИЛИ, причем одна из вертикальных шин коммутатора через последовательно соединенные элемент задержки и элемент ИЛИ подключена к входу распределителя импульсов, а две другие вертикальные шины - соответственно к суммирующим и вычитающим входам реверсивного шагового переключателя, выходы которого соединены с входами выходного цифроаналогового преобразователя, а выход генератора импульсов подключен к второму входу элемента ИЛИ. Источники информации, принятые во внимание при экспертизе 1.Авторское свидетельство СССР № 357553, кл. G 05 В 19/08, 1970. 2.РогИнский В. Н. Основы дискретной автоматики, М., Связь, 1975, с. 3 8-351. 3.Авторское свидетельство СССР № 316077, кл. G 05 В 19/00, 1970 (прототип).

f)

Похожие патенты SU932463A1

название год авторы номер документа
Программное регулирующее устройство 1979
  • Шорохов Владимир Анатольевич
SU847277A1
Устройство для синусно-косинусного преобразования кода в напяжение 1982
  • Мясников Виктор Васильевич
  • Илюшин Сергей Александрович
SU1089588A1
Аналого-цифровой квадратор 1983
  • Добрыдень Владимир Александрович
  • Пузько Игорь Данилович
SU1120374A1
Временное задающее устройство 1983
  • Москаленко Алексей Анисимович
  • Кулаков Геннадий Тихонович
  • Кулаков Александр Тихонович
  • Коробский Виктор Андреевич
  • Букатый Эдуард Владимирович
SU1156003A1
Устройство для моделирования воспроизводства продукта в экономических системах 1987
  • Осипов Геннадий Александрович
SU1430974A1
Система программного управления процессом порционной вакуумной обработки стали 1989
  • Дубовец Анатолий Маркович
SU1684347A2
Функциональный генератор 1985
  • Демин Станислав Борисович
SU1309052A1
Генератор импульсов ступенчато-трапецеидальной формы 1990
  • Суханов Борис Александрович
SU1725367A1
Преобразователь угловых перемещений в код 1985
  • Черногорский Александр Николаевич
  • Цветков Виктор Иванович
  • Ипатов Александр Николаевич
  • Гринфельд Михаил Леонидович
  • Левенталь Вадим Филиппович
SU1311024A1
Сенсорный переключатель 1982
  • Антонов Александр Васильевич
  • Герасимов Юрий Михайлович
  • Будников Владислав Викторович
SU1051720A1

Иллюстрации к изобретению SU 932 463 A1

Реферат патента 1982 года Программное задающее устройство для электронных аналоговых регуляторов

Формула изобретения SU 932 463 A1

SU 932 463 A1

Авторы

Шорохов Владимир Анатольевич

Шорохова Ирина Александровна

Костенко Александр Павлович

Даты

1982-05-30Публикация

1980-04-16Подача